Supercooled Water.

Abstract

In response to an invitation from Annual Reviews of Physical Chemistry, recent progress in defining and unravelling the anomalies of supercooled water and their origin has been reviewed. Some of the most useful new results have come fom binary solution studies. The field is presently in an interesting position with many of the most important properties now measured with acceptable precision and several noncomplimentary theories in circulation to explain them.
